Lyndhurst PD Rescues Mom, Newborn Trapped In Apartment After Dad's Car Runs Out Of Gas
Lyndhurst Police Sgt. Rick Pizzuti could hear a newborn baby cry as the mother on the other end of the line – unable to get to her front door – pleaded for help. The baby's father was on the other side of town when his car ran out of gas, she said. Come quick. Moments later, a team of borough officers forced their way in, cut the umbilical cord and wrapped the infant in clean towels while awaiting an ambulance.
